CIMAGE Anti-Ragging Cell

CIMAGE Group of Institutions is committed to maintaining a ragging-free, safe, and inclusive campus. The Anti-Ragging Cell works actively to prevent any form of ragging through awareness programs, strict monitoring, and quick disciplinary action. Students can report incidents through helpline numbers or online forms. As per UGC guidelines, submission of an anti-ragging affidavit is mandatory for all new admissions. CIMAGE ensures a respectful and supportive environment where every student feels secure and valued.

Objectives of the Anti-Ragging Cell

To eliminate ragging in all forms and ensure students feel secure and welcomed. The cell promotes awareness, monitors student behavior, and takes disciplinary action when needed.

Anti-Ragging Laws and Guidelines (UGC/MHRD)

CIMAGE follows the UGC Regulations on curbing ragging, which outline punishable offenses and mandatory measures to prevent ragging in higher education institutions.

Composition of the Anti-Ragging Committee

The committee comprises faculty members, administrative staff, and student representatives who handle anti-ragging policies and address complaints promptly.

Awareness Programs and Campaigns

Regular seminars, orientations, and poster campaigns are conducted to educate students about the negative effects and consequences of ragging.

Anti-Ragging Helpline & Complaint Mechanism

Students can report ragging anonymously via email, helpline numbers, or the online complaint form. Quick action is ensured with complete confidentiality.

Roles and Responsibilities of the Cell

Conduct regular awareness programs Monitor campus activities Handle complaints confidentially Take necessary disciplinary action against offenders
